From: Stefan Monnier
Subject: [elpa] externals/debbugs a447400 204/311: Document debbugs-gnu-send-mail-function
Date: Sun, 29 Nov 2020 18:42:12 -0500 (EST)

branch: externals/debbugs
commit a447400ed453a7330ff0b69506e9b408b0ab1e81
Author: Lars Ingebrigtsen <larsi@gnus.org>
Commit: Lars Ingebrigtsen <larsi@gnus.org>

    Document debbugs-gnu-send-mail-function
 debbugs-gnu.el  | 15 ++++++++++++---
 debbugs-ug.texi |  3 +++
 2 files changed, 15 insertions(+), 3 deletions(-)

diff --git a/debbugs-gnu.el b/debbugs-gnu.el
index dd17e83..4169dc8 100644
--- a/debbugs-gnu.el
+++ b/debbugs-gnu.el
@@ -202,6 +202,18 @@
              (const "tagged"))
   :version "24.1")
+(defcustom debbugs-gnu-send-mail-function nil
+  "A function to send control messages from debbugs.
+If nil, the value of `send-mail-function' is used instead."
+  :type '(radio (function-item message-send-mail-with-sendmail)
+               (function-item message-smtpmail-send-it)
+               (function-item smtpmail-send-it)
+               (function-item feedmail-send-it)
+               (function-item message-send-mail-with-mailclient
+                              :tag "Use Mailclient package")
+               (function :tag "Other"))
+  :version "25.1")
 (defcustom debbugs-gnu-suppress-closed t
   "If non-nil, don't show closed bugs."
   :group 'debbugs-gnu
@@ -1321,9 +1333,6 @@ MERGED is the list of bugs merged with this one."
           (re-search-forward "#\\([0-9]+\\)" nil t)))
      (string-to-number (match-string 1)))))
-(defvar debbugs-gnu-send-mail-function nil
-  "A function to send control messages from debbugs.")
 (defvar debbugs-gnu-completion-table
    (lambda (string)
diff --git a/debbugs-ug.texi b/debbugs-ug.texi
index 2d5f435..9ba5a33 100644
--- a/debbugs-ug.texi
+++ b/debbugs-ug.texi
@@ -569,6 +569,9 @@ The username, read interactively, is either a package name 
or an email
 address.  The tag to be set is also read interactively.
 @end table
+How the control messages are sent is controlled by the
+@code{debbugs-gnu-send-mail-function} variable.
 @node Minor Mode
 @chapter Minor Mode

